Transaction 4feffef32d15be4e86221abd562600a6e71252eea13b21028a615e40bab799e9

1 Input
2 Outputs
  • 4feffef32d15be4e86221abd562600a6e71252eea13b21028a615e40bab799e9:0
  • value  24963
    address  38kbH5JTzhRMiEFd5iVP71uZoab9rYgwu9
  • 4feffef32d15be4e86221abd562600a6e71252eea13b21028a615e40bab799e9:1
  • value  7705302998
    address  36FKESYA5N7oTKnXYqNu3Dfu8A6CXjJ3Qq